How a dehumidifier works in Batcombe

The idea is simple: the unit draws in damp air, the moisture condenses and collects in a tank (or drains away), and drier air is pushed back into the room. For a cellar or cold room in Batcombe, you'll want a model suited to cool spaces and matched to the volume you're drying.

How much does it cost in Batcombe?

To dry out a damp room or cellar in Batcombe, hire works out at a few pounds to £25 a day depending on capacity — far less than buying an industrial unit that then sits idle in the garage.

Will it push my electricity bill up?

Running costs stay reasonable: a domestic unit often runs a few hours a day thanks to the built-in humidistat, which switches it off once the target humidity is reached.

How quickly will it dry my room?

It depends how wet things are: a damp room clears in days, while drying-out works in Batcombe may need a week or more of continuous running.

Can it help with mould on the walls?

It's the practical fix while you sort any underlying issue: drop the humidity and the black spots in Batcombe lose the damp they feed on.
